Keyboard extensions should have read-only access to storage shared with the containing app.

Summary:
Currently keyboard extensions require "Full Access" in order to be conigured by their containing app or extended using in-app purchase. This forces developers to frighten users by requesting access to a level of capability that they don't need - there is no need for these extensions to have network access or to write to a part of the filesystem that is visible to the containing app.

Steps to Reproduce:
Keyboard extensions that use IAP currently require "Full Access". 

Expected Results:
It would be nice to be able to offer extended features without scaring consumers and looking shady.

Actual Results:
Search Google for "keyboard extension full access" to see consumer reactions to this.
